## Sweeper Service: Orphan Reaper

Orphan Reaper scans the Cloudmint fleet nightly for resources with no parent record — dangling volumes, unreferenced snapshots, stale load balancer entries — and deletes anything older than 72 hours. Dry-run is the default; pass force=true to act. Results are written to the reaper-audit table. Do not run two sweeps concurrently; the lock table is advisory only. All calls go through the internal gateway and require authentication. Use the key issued for the sweeper's service account, shown below.

gateway credential: kto23_LX9A4ys6i4nzHtpOLNLodKK

**Key Ceremony Checklist — Item 4: LocaleHarvest Script**

Before signing the release, run the LocaleHarvest extraction script against the Bramblewick UI repo and confirm all translation strings are captured in the manifest. Verify the checksum matches the ceremony record, then have the second custodian countersign. Unlocking the signing token for this step requires the recovery passphrase listed directly below.

unlock words, tagaf-hahif: ralwyn-lammir-rusax-sormir

## Session Handling: Turnstile Counter Service

The Gatewick turnstile counter at Harrow Fen Stadium reports entry tallies every ten seconds. Each reporting node holds a session with the aggregation service; sessions expire after one hour and auto-renew on heartbeat. New team members should know that stale sessions cause gaps in the count graph, not errors. To query the staging aggregator manually, use the bearer token below.

session JWT of yawep-yawep = eyJhbGciOiJIUzI1NiIsInR5cCI6IkpXVCJ9.eyJzdWIiOiI3pWF3_In0.aXYsHiog